ABOUT THE ROLE
Tutor Intelligence is seeking a robot electrical engineer to ideate, prototype, iterate, deploy, and scale up new robot electrical systems. This mostly comes down to power electronics and PCB design, with a whole bunch of firmware.
Example projects you might work on:
- Motor control boards
- Power distribution boards
- Battery management systems
- Actuator selection and integration
- Sensor selection and integration

What Massachusetts Employers Look For
The qualifications that appear most often in electrical engineer jobs across Massachusetts.
- Bachelor's degree in electrical engineering or a closely related engineering discipline
- Proficiency with CAD or EDA tools such as AutoCAD Electrical, Altium Designer, or MATLAB
- Experience with power systems, circuit design, or embedded systems depending on the sub-field
- Familiarity with industry standards including NEC, IEEE, IEC, or UL requirements
- Professional Engineer (PE) license or Engineer-in-Training (EIT) status for regulated roles
- Ability to obtain or maintain a security clearance for defense and government contract positions

How much do electrical engineers make in Massachusetts?
Electrical engineers in Massachusetts earn a median of about $127,720 a year, based on May 2025 Bureau of Labor Statistics wage data, ranging from around $78,140 for the lowest 10% to over $176,470 for the top 10%. Pay rises with experience, specialty, and employer.
